excel怎么插入excel表格(Excel插入表格)


在Excel操作中,插入外部Excel表格数据是一项高频需求,其实现方式直接影响数据完整性、可维护性及操作效率。传统复制粘贴虽简单快捷,但易破坏原始数据格式与关联性;而超链接、对象嵌入等技术能保留动态链接,却对文件路径依赖性强。随着数据量增长,Power Query、VBA等进阶方案通过参数化配置与自动化脚本,实现了跨文件数据的高效整合。不同场景需权衡格式保真、更新频率、协作需求等因素,例如临时报告适合截图插入,长期数据分析则需构建结构化数据管道。本文将从技术原理、操作流程、适用边界等八个维度深度解析Excel插入表格的核心逻辑与实践策略。
一、基础复制粘贴法
直接复制源表格区域后粘贴至目标文件,是最简单的数据迁移方式。操作时需注意:
- 选择性粘贴选项可保留数值或公式
- 粘贴后数据与源文件建立断链关系
- 格式刷可快速统一字体、边框样式
该方法适用于静态数据呈现,但存在三大局限:无法同步源数据更新、复杂公式可能失效、格式易错位。对于含多级表头或条件格式的表格,建议先调整源表格式再进行复制。
二、超链接嵌入法
通过插入超链接调用外部Excel文件,可实现动态数据访问:
- 右键选择"链接"选项卡
- 设置文件路径与显示文字
- 勾选"单元格值随源文件变化"
此方法保持数据实时同步,但存在路径依赖风险。当源文件移动或重命名时,链接将失效。建议配合文档属性中的"服务器路径"设置,或使用相对路径增强稳定性。
三、对象嵌入法
采用"选择性粘贴-Microsoft Excel工作表对象"方式,可完整保留:
特性 | 复制粘贴 | 超链接 | 对象嵌入 |
---|---|---|---|
格式保真度 | ★★☆ | ★☆☆ | ★★★ |
数据联动性 | 无 | 强 | 中等 |
文件依赖 | 无 | 高 | 中 |
嵌入对象会携带独立工作表结构,双击即可激活编辑模式。但文件体积增大明显,且跨平台兼容性较差,不建议用于移动端报表场景。
四、Power Query整合法
通过数据连接与查询折叠技术,实现结构化数据整合:
- 数据选项卡→获取数据→来自文件
- 加载指定工作表至Power Query编辑器
- 应用筛选、排序等转换操作
- 关闭并加载至工作表
该方法支持增量刷新与参数化配置,但需注意:复杂查询可能增加刷新时间;自定义列公式需符合M语言规范。适合处理百万级数据量的常态化分析需求。
五、VBA代码植入法
编写宏命令可实现自动化表格插入:
Sub InsertTable()
Dim ws As Worksheet
Set ws = ThisWorkbook.Sheets.Add(After:= _
ThisWorkbook.Sheets(ThisWorkbook.Sheets.Count))
With ws.QueryTables.Add(Connection:= _
"URL;FILE,C:pathsource.xlsx", Destination:=ws.Range("A1"))
.BackgroundQuery = True
.RefreshOnFileOpen = False
End With
End Sub
该代码自动新建工作表并建立数据连接,可通过修改文件路径参数适配不同场景。需注意启用宏权限,且源文件结构变更时需同步更新代码。
六、图片插入法
将表格转换为图片插入,适用于防篡改场景:
- 源表Ctrl+A→按PrtSc截图
- 在目标文件插入图片→右键锁定纵横比
- 建议保存为PNG格式保留透明背景
此方法彻底断绝数据关联,但损失交互性。对敏感数据报表尤为适用,可配合水印功能增强安全性。
七、数据透视表法
通过多维数据集整合外部数据源:
- 数据模型→添加新数据源→选择外部文件
- 创建数据透视表并定义字段布局
- 设置定时刷新机制(外部工具)
该方法实现多表关联分析,但要求源文件保持相同结构。适合管理类报表制作,需注意字段名称一致性问题。
八、第三方插件辅助法
工具类插件可拓展插入方式:
插件 | 功能 | 适用场景 |
---|---|---|
Kutools | 批量合并工作表 | 多文件汇总 |
Power Spread | 跨平台数据抓取 | 云端协同 |
Excel Add-in | 自动化刷新设置 | 定时报表 |
插件安装需注意版本兼容性,建议从官方渠道获取。部分付费插件提供数据追踪、异常报警等增值服务,可显著提升复杂场景下的操作效率。
通过上述八种方法的对比可见,选择插入方式需综合考虑数据特性、更新频率、协作需求等因素。对于临时性展示,基础复制或截图更为高效;长期数据分析则推荐Power Query或数据模型;涉及多部门协作的场景,宜采用超链接结合共享工作簿的方式。实际操作中常需组合多种技术,如先用Power Query整合数据,再通过VBA实现自动化刷新,最终以数据透视表形式呈现。掌握这些核心技术点,可显著提升Excel数据处理的专业度与工作效率。





